Description Position Summary

Responsible for the procurement of a variety of goods and services on a complex and technical level consistent with company policy and procedures.

Essential Functions
  • Review and processes Purchase Requisition s.
  • Confers with vendors to obtain بهدف product or service information such as price, availability, and delivery.
  • Complies with all Federal, State, and Tribal laws relative to the purchasing function.
  • Selects products and/or services for purchase by testing, observing, or examining items or services rendered. Estimates values according to knowledge of market price.
  • Determines method of procurement such as direct purchase or bid.
  • Prepares informal and formal bid requests.
  • Converts Purchase Requisition s to Purchase Orders.
  • Reviews bid proposals and negotiates contracts within budgetary limitations and scope of authority.
  • Maintains procurement records such as items or services purchased, costs, delivery, product, quality or performance and inventories.
  • Discusses defective or unacceptable goods or services with quería receiving, personnel, users, vendors, and others to determine root cause problems and take corrective action.
  • Expedites deliveries of goods and/or services to users.
  • Coordinates activities with other departments and outside entities.
  • Process claims with Vendors for damaged materials, monitor invoices for accuracy, and obtain credits where appropriate.
  • Maintains contract and negotiates with Vendors.
  • Keeps informed ofացնելու new products.
  • Develops new sources of supply.
  • Evaluates vendor performance.
  • Plans and carries glace activities within the jurisdiction of the position to ensure prompt placement of orders for materials, supplies, equipment, and other related items in the quantity required when and where needed.
  • Communicates and reports on the status of pending critical purchases to assure management's awareness of any possible delays that might affect planning.
  • Keeps informed on cost of goods, pricing trends, and other matters, knowledge that will result in minimizing cost of purchased items.
  • Remains familiar with UCC regulations as they pertain to the purchasing function.
  • Abides by the STGC guidelines as applicable.
  • Selects and maintains sources of supply using progressive purchasing techniques and methods.
  • Prepares quarterly status report on major purchases and activities.
  • Performs work independently with minimal supervision.
  • Performs other duties assigned by the Purchasing Manager.
